Page 8: Evaluation of Finland meeting

The first meeting was quite a challenge. It was the first time we were working together. Most of us didn't know the other members of the group. That's why we hardly had time for "traditional Finnish cups of coffee". But everything went well in the end and we managed to find compromises in all the topics we dealt with.

I think we should improve communication strategies. Sometimes discourse went astray because of misunderstandings. We need to better stick to rules and application form. We should insist on constant update of info regarding Erasmus+ policies to make sure we abide by the requirements. We should work harder on cohesion and cooperation.. The group is doing very well but that feature should be reinforced. Pre-visit arrangements should be shared more. Managerial roles can be implemented during visits and during the time at home.

Being more clear of what tasks follow although this is not much of a problem as we constantly communicate. For instance, when we left Finland I got the impression that each country completes one evaluation form. It's OK it was clarified there is one for each person.

I would like to have the final agreements about the things to do very clear at the end of the meetings, so you can start working with your students when you come back to your school without having changes afterwards. .

In future meetings decisions should be taken paying attention to the opinions of all of us.

Page 9: Evaluation of Finland meeting

1. More time for discussions or organized working sessions/workshops in which we could work on a topic in smaller groups and then present it for further discussion in the whole group. Eg. working session/workshop on how to plan activity one, or on didactical practices (I think that we have very different ways of teaching - so it could be used both as an inspiration for all of us, but also contribute to a better understanding of how the countries look at an activity like the timetable or Power Point presentations etc. - we had some discussion on these topics, and I'm not sure we reached a complete understanding or agreement on them. 2. Keeping time better - both during coffee breaks and during sessions. 3. I would also have liked to hear more about/ having a discussion about what we think innovation and entrepreneurship is and how we work with it in our schools - also if it is almost not there yet.

We can achieve more in less time if we all know well what the application states, so that we do not waste time "re-building" the project. Everyone should spend sufficient time in studying it.

Less focus on details and more on broad lines.

I would like more warm feelings between the partners.

More time to project and describe the way every partner should cooperate itself. I think we should stick to the steps showed in the application form and not change too much by the way.

We should open the agenda more before the meeting as different people have different ideas on the issues.
